Integration of Multiple Services:
To stay competitive, online recharge apps are diversifying their services. Many platforms now offer integrated services beyond mobile recharges, including DTH, broadband, utility bill payments, and even online shopping vouchers. This consolidation provides users with a one-stop solution for their digital transactions, simplifying their financial management.

Contactless and Secure Transactions:
As the importance of contactless transactions continues to grow, online recharge apps are investing in robust security measures. Features like two-factor authentication, biometric verification, and tokenization ensure secure transactions, building trust among users. The future will likely see advancements in blockchain technology for even more secure and transparent financial interactions.

Expansion of Payment Options:
Diversity in payment options is a key trend in the future of online recharge apps. Beyond traditional debit and credit cards, apps are integrating digital wallets, UPI payments, and even cryptocurrencies. This expansion caters to a wider audience, ensuring that users can choose the payment method that aligns with their preferences and convenience.

Rural and Vernacular Outreach:
While urban areas have seen widespread adoption of online recharge apps, the future will likely focus on penetrating rural markets. Apps may introduce vernacular language support, targeted marketing campaigns, and simplified interfaces to cater to users in remote areas, thereby fostering digital inclusivity.
